Transaction 8d28ca6f1a38901c312760fd109a618da03d5a274375b25142066c52d66182c7
1 Input
2 Outputs
- 8d28ca6f1a38901c312760fd109a618da03d5a274375b25142066c52d66182c7:0
- 8d28ca6f1a38901c312760fd109a618da03d5a274375b25142066c52d66182c7:1
value 317481
address 1K3YYr5HAp4Lub1TS6WXczTwcCSwWjW9JN
value 108203860
address 377bBzu6neemusNXnmJf4AhVfCrikephTB